Overview A Steam Program Coordinator is responsible for coordinating and managing a STEAM (Science, Technology, Engineering, Arts, and Mathematics) program. This includes developing and implementing curriculum, recruiting and training staff, and managing the program budget. The Steam Program Coordinator is also responsible for ensuring that the program meets its goals and objectives.
